                Homeless guy in alley on the right at the eighteen second mark is ubiquitous Columbo extra Mike Lally. Lally appears in a slew of Columbo episodes in uncredited bit roles and was actually in the most Columbo episodes right after Peter Falk.

                                  Columbo challenging cocky magician The Great Santini to get out of some handcuffs in order to confirm that he's the killer. Love how Columbo uses Santini's arrogance to his advantage.
